Activities - how the charity spends its money
FORS exists to support the children at Reed First School to provide additional equipment and resources and also support school trips and workshops. It is currently working towards providing outside equipment and resources. Fundraising has encompassed a variety of events such as sponsored bike rides, Christmas Fayres, Fashion Shows, tea parties, quiz and race nights.

Governing document
It is not the full text of the charity's governing document.
CONSTITUTION ADOPTED 10 JANUARY 2002 as amended on 27 Nov 2019
Charitable objects
TO ADVANCE THE EDUCATION OF THE PUPILS IN THE SCHOOL IN PARTICULAR BY 1. DEVELOPING EFFECTIVE RELATIONSHIPS BETWEEN STAFF PARENTS AND OTHERS ASSOCIATED WITH THE SCHOOL; 2. ENGAGING IN ACTIVITIES OR PROVIDING FACILITIES OR EQUIPMENT WHICH SUPPORT THE SCHOOL AND ADVANCE THE EDUCATION OF THE PUPILS;
